Cell theory was given by Schleiden and Schwann in the year of 1839 which gave a basic idea about the cells and its relationships with an organism. The research on plants were done by Schleiden and on animals were done by Schwann.

Theodor Schwann was a German physiologist and physician who made different contributions in the field of science. His discovery of Schwann cells on neurons, the pepsin enzyme in stomach as well as the cell theory are worth remembering. Theodor Schwann did his research on animals and saw that the animal bodies are made up of different cells and their products just like plants. So on 1839, along with Matthias Schleiden, he gave the cell theory which stated that all the living organisms are formed of one or more cells and they are the structural and functional units of living organisms.
